  • Page 4 SAFETY INFORMATION DANGER: Risk of Electric Shock. Do not permit any electric appliance, such as a light, telephone, radio, or television, within 5 feet (1.5 m) of a spa. DANGER: Risk of injury. a) Replace damaged cord immediately. b) Do not bury cord. c) Connect to a grounded, grounding type receptacle only.

    USAGE INSTRUCTIONS CONTROL PANEL AIRJET WITH WI-FI AIRJET ON/OFF BUTTON: After activating the GFCI, press and hold the button for 2 seconds. button will light up green and the control panel can now be used. Press and hold the button for 2 seconds to turn off all activated functions. CELSIUS/FAHRENHEIT TOGGLE: The temperature can be displayed in either Fahrenheit or Celsius.
  • Page 12 USAGE INSTRUCTIONS MASSAGE SYSTEM BUTTON: Press the button to activate the massage system, which has a 30-minute auto-shutoff feature. The light of the button becomes red when activated. Do not run the massage system when the cover is attached. Air can accumulate inside the hot tub and cause irreparable damage to the cover.

  • Page 17 DISASSEMBLY & STORAGE INSTRUCTIONS CLEANING A: 1 Detergent residue and dissolved solids from bathing suits and chemicals may build up on the hot tub walls. Use soap and water to clean the walls and rinse thoroughly. Do not use hard brushes or abrasive cleaners. DEFLATING Only For Inflatable Hot Tubs: To deflate the hot tub, follow the drawings.
  • Page 18: Troubleshooting

    DISASSEMBLY & STORAGE INSTRUCTIONS REPAIRING When repairing the cover or interior floor: Use the provided repair patch to repair tears or punctures. • Clean the area, and carefully peel the patch. • Stick the patch over the damaged area. • Wait 30 seconds before re-inflation. When repairing the walls or exterior floor: Use the provided repair patch and glue (not included) to repair tears or punctures.
